Output d63daa1f8192586fc3dce126e633dbf0373f99b499c2d27d97b4ff0aa4075e0d:1
- value
- 692558
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d75feea180718976c1a8f9e328d4ea2791d10f2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DtydYA6kYjzP34kEnMUHQ1M6MvSko8M2x
- transaction
- d63daa1f8192586fc3dce126e633dbf0373f99b499c2d27d97b4ff0aa4075e0d
- confirmations
- 452988
- spent
- true